What Is an Energy Storage System (ESS)?
An Energy Storage System (ESS) is a smart backup solution that stores electricity and supplies it when your home needs power.
Unlike traditional backup systems that simply switch on during an outage, modern ESS solutions are designed to manage energy more intelligently. They can work with the electricity grid, solar panels, and advanced lithium battery inverters to deliver dependable power when it's needed most.
In simple words, if your phone has a power bank to keep it running, an ESS does the same job for your home.

Why Lithium Battery Inverters Are Changing Home Energy Storage
One of the biggest reasons modern Energy Storage Systems are becoming popular is the adoption of lithium battery inverter technology. Compared with traditional battery systems, lithium technology offers several practical advantages:
- Faster charging between power cuts
- Longer battery life
- Compact design that fits modern homes
- Zero water topping
- Minimal maintenance
- Reliable day-to-day performance
For homeowners, this means less time managing the backup system and more confidence that it will perform when needed.

Frequently Asked Questions (FAQs)
1. What is an Energy Storage System (ESS)?
An Energy Storage System (ESS) stores electricity for later use. It helps provide backup power during outages and can also store excess solar energy generated during the day.
2. How is an ESS different from a traditional inverter?
A traditional inverter primarily provides backup during power cuts. An ESS combines intelligent energy management with energy storage, helping optimize power use while offering reliable backup.
3. Why is a lithium battery inverter recommended for an ESS?
A lithium battery inverter offers faster charging, longer battery life, compact size, and minimal maintenance, making it ideal for modern home energy storage systems.
4. Can an Energy Storage System work with solar panels?
Yes. An ESS can store surplus electricity generated by rooftop solar panels and use it later when sunlight isn't available or during power outages.
